SB505124 is a selective inhibitor of TGFβR for ALK4, ALK5 with IC50 of 129 nM and 47 nM in cell-free assays, respectively, also inhibits ALK7, but does not inhibit ALK1, 2, 3, or 6.
An inhibitor of Activin receptor-like kinase 5
| Canonical Smiles | CC1=NC(=CC=C1)C2=C(N=C(N2)C(C)(C)C)C3=CC4=C(C=C3)OCO4 |
|---|---|
| IUPAC Name | 2-[4-(1,3-benzodioxol-5-yl)-2-tert-butyl-1H-imidazol-5-yl]-6-methylpyridine |
| InChIKey | WGZOTBUYUFBEPZ-UHFFFAOYSA-N |
| INCHI | 1S/C20H21N3O2/c1-12-6-5-7-14(21-12)18-17(22-19(23-18)20(2,3)4)13-8-9-15-16(10-13)25-11-24-15/h5-10H,11H2,1-4H3,(H,22,23) |
| Isomeric SMILES | CC1=NC(=CC=C1)C2=C(N=C(N2)C(C)(C)C)C3=CC4=C(C=C3)OCO4 |
| PubChem CID | 9858940 |
| Molecular Weight | 335.4 |

| Solubility | DMSO 67 mg/mL Water <1 mg/mL Ethanol 67 mg/mL |
|---|---|
| Melt Point(°C) | 168 °C |
| Molecular Weight | 335.400 g/mol |
| XLogP3 | 4.300 |
| Hydrogen Bond Donor Count | 1 |
| Hydrogen Bond Acceptor Count | 4 |
| Rotatable Bond Count | 3 |
| Exact Mass | 335.163 Da |
| Monoisotopic Mass | 335.163 Da |
| Topological Polar Surface Area | 60.000 Ų |
| Heavy Atom Count | 25 |
| Formal Charge | 0 |
| Complexity | 466.000 |
| Isotope Atom Count | 0 |
| Defined Atom Stereocenter Count | 0 |
| Undefined Atom Stereocenter Count | 0 |
| Defined Bond Stereocenter Count | 0 |
| Undefined Bond Stereocenter Count | 0 |
| The total count of all stereochemical bonds | 0 |
| Covalently-Bonded Unit Count | 1 |
